Martha Graham’s name was internationally recognized as part of the
modern dance world, and though trends in choreography continue to
change, her influence on dance as an art form endures. In this book,
the first extended feminist look at the modern dance pioneer, Victoria
Thoms explores the cult of Graham and her dancing through a critical
lens that exposes the gendered meaning behind much of her work. Thoms
synthesizes a diverse archive of material on Graham from films,
photographs, memoir and critique in order to highlight Graham’s
unique contribution to the dance world and arts culture in general.
